The act of wading through water in dreams often symbolizes a journey through emotions and subconscious thoughts. Water is a powerful element in dream interpretation, representing feelings, intuition, and the flow of life. When one dreams of wading, it can indicate a need to confront and navigate through these emotional waters. The depth and clarity of the water can also reflect the dreamer’s current emotional state, offering insight into their inner world.
In many dream books, wading is associated with the idea of progress and movement. It suggests that the dreamer is actively engaging with their feelings rather than avoiding them. This engagement can lead to personal growth and a deeper understanding of oneself. The way one wades—whether confidently or hesitantly—can reveal how the dreamer approaches challenges in their waking life.
Additionally, wading can represent a transitional phase. It may signify that the dreamer is in the process of moving from one stage of life to another, often marked by uncertainty and exploration. The water may symbolize the unknown aspects of this transition, and wading through it indicates a willingness to explore these new territories, both emotionally and spiritually. This journey can be both enlightening and daunting, reflecting the complexities of change.
Moreover, wading can also highlight the importance of self-reflection. It encourages the dreamer to take a moment to pause and consider their feelings and experiences. By wading through the waters of their subconscious, they may uncover hidden desires, fears, or unresolved issues. This introspection can lead to clarity and a renewed sense of purpose, making wading a significant symbol in the realm of dreams.

wade in different cultural contexts in dreams
In the realm of dream interpretation, the act of wading through water often symbolizes a journey through emotions and subconscious thoughts. In Western culture, water is frequently associated with cleansing and renewal, suggesting that to wade may indicate a desire to confront and process one’s feelings. This cultural lens views the act as a necessary step toward emotional healing, where the dreamer is encouraged to embrace their vulnerabilities as they navigate through the murky depths of their psyche.
Conversely, in Slavic traditions, water carries a dual significance. It can represent both life and danger, reflecting the unpredictable nature of the human experience. To wade through water in a dream may signify a confrontation with one’s fears or the unknown. Slavic folklore often emphasizes the importance of water as a boundary between the living and the spiritual realms, suggesting that wading could also symbolize a connection to ancestral wisdom or a call to heed the lessons of the past.
Eastern cultures, particularly those influenced by Taoist philosophy, view water as a source of harmony and balance. In this context, wading through water might represent the dreamer’s journey toward inner peace. It signifies the ability to adapt and flow with life’s challenges, embodying the principle of ‘going with the flow.’ This perspective encourages individuals to embrace change and uncertainty, suggesting that wading is a transformative experience that leads to personal growth.
In Oriental traditions, water is often linked to the concept of the unconscious mind. To wade through water in a dream may indicate a deep exploration of one’s inner self, revealing hidden desires or unresolved conflicts. This cultural interpretation underscores the importance of self-reflection and the need to delve into the depths of one’s psyche. Thus, the act of wading becomes a powerful metaphor for the journey of self-discovery, urging the dreamer to embrace their true essence and navigate the complexities of their emotional landscape.
